Seminar: Future-proofing Swedish health and social care with healthtech

The potential of technology to improve people's health has never been greater. AI, digital health platforms and smart welfare technology are changing the way we think about health and care. The healthtech revolution is here - and it gives people greater opportunities for improved quality of life, security and personalized care. There is also significant potential for Sweden to take a position with new innovative healthtech solutions that can be exported globally in the growing world market for digital health. But how do we achieve good development and ensure that these new solutions are utilized and also implemented widely in Swedish health and social care? 

TechSverige invites you to a seminar where we launch the report Healthtech - for people's health, care and quality of life. We present concrete examples where the use of various healthtech solutions has created great value. We also present proposals to increase the use and utilization of healthtech, and invite to a conversation about the way forward.
